How Scaffolding Reduces Fall-Related Injuries

Stable Working Platforms

One of the most obvious ways scaffolding improves safety is by giving workers a solid, level surface to stand on while working at height. Unlike makeshift solutions such as ladders or stacked materials, scaffolding is engineered to distribute weight evenly and remain stable even when multiple workers and tools are present.

Guardrails and Toe Boards

Modern scaffolding systems include guardrails along open edges and toe boards at platform level. Guardrails prevent workers from accidentally stepping off the edge, while toe boards stop tools, debris, or materials from falling and injuring people below.

Safe Access Points

Proper scaffolding includes designated ladders, stairways, or ramps for climbing between levels. This eliminates the need for workers to improvise unsafe methods of getting up and down, which is a common cause of slips and falls on unregulated sites.

How Scaffolding Supports Safer Material Handling

Reducing Manual Lifting Risks

Scaffolding platforms allow materials to be positioned closer to the work area, reducing the need for workers to carry heavy loads up ladders or across uneven ground. This lowers the risk of strain injuries and accidents caused by manual handling.

Organized Storage of Tools and Equipment

Scaffolding platforms often include space for temporarily storing tools and materials in an organized way, preventing clutter that could otherwise lead to trips, falls, or dropped objects.

Controlled Load Distribution

Professionally installed scaffolding is designed with specific load limits in mind. This ensures that the weight of workers, tools, and materials is distributed safely, preventing structural failure due to overloading.

The Role of Proper Scaffolding Design and Inspection

Engineering to Local Safety Standards

Scaffolding isn’t something that should be assembled casually. It must be designed and erected according to local construction safety codes, taking into account the height of the structure, expected load, and environmental conditions such as wind exposure.

Regular Inspections

Even a well-built scaffold can become unsafe over time due to weather exposure, wear, or accidental damage. Routine inspections — ideally conducted by trained professionals — help identify issues like loose connections, corrosion, or structural instability before they lead to accidents.

Weather Considerations

High winds, heavy rain, or extreme heat can all affect scaffold stability and worker safety. Proper scaffolding design accounts for these factors, and site managers should have protocols in place for suspending work during hazardous weather conditions.

Types of Scaffolding Safety Features

Bracing and Cross Support

Diagonal bracing adds structural rigidity to a scaffold, preventing swaying or collapse under load. This is especially important for taller structures where lateral stability becomes a bigger concern.

Base Plates and Sole Boards

A scaffold is only as safe as its foundation. Base plates distribute weight evenly at ground level, while sole boards help prevent sinking or shifting on soft or uneven ground.

Safety Netting and Debris Screens

On larger sites, safety netting is often used alongside scaffolding to catch falling objects and protect both workers and pedestrians below. Debris screens serve a similar purpose while also containing dust and small particles.

Non-Slip Platform Surfaces

Platform boards with textured or non-slip surfaces reduce the risk of workers slipping, particularly in wet or dusty conditions common on active construction sites.

Training and Human Factors in Scaffolding Safety

Proper Worker Training

Even the best-engineered scaffold can’t guarantee safety if workers aren’t trained to use it correctly. Employees should understand how to climb safely, how to move materials without overloading platforms, and what to do in an emergency.

Clear Communication and Signage

Job sites should have clear signage indicating load limits, access points, and any areas under maintenance or repair. This reduces confusion and helps prevent accidental misuse of scaffolding structures.

Supervision and Accountability

Assigning a competent person to oversee scaffolding use, inspections, and compliance ensures that safety standards are consistently maintained throughout the project, not just at the initial setup stage.

Best Practices for Maximizing Scaffolding Safety

  1. Always use certified scaffolding services for design, installation, and inspection rather than relying on informal or unqualified labor.
  2. Conduct daily visual inspections before each shift to catch any changes in structural condition.
  3. Enforce load limits strictly, ensuring workers understand how much weight a platform can safely hold.
  4. Provide proper personal protective equipment (PPE), including harnesses where required, in addition to the scaffold’s built-in safety features.
  5. Establish clear emergency procedures in case of scaffold failure, severe weather, or worker injury.
  6. Keep platforms clear of unnecessary clutter to reduce trip hazards and maintain safe movement.
